The bar graph shows the number of ice-cream flavours sold at a shop in a day.
- What percentage of the ice-creams sold was cranberry ice-creams? Give your answer correct to 1 decimal place.
- The cost of each ice-cream was the same. The amount of money collected for vanilla ice-creams was $140 more than the amount of money collected for cherry ice-creams. What was the total amount of money collected from the sale of all the ice-creams?
(a)
Total number of ice-creams sold
= 100 + 35 + 65 + 70
= 270
Percentage of the ice-creams sold that was cranberry ice-creams
=
Cranberry ice-creamsTotal ice-creams x 100
=
70270 x 100
≈ 25.9%
(b)
Number of more vanilla ice-creams than cherry ice-creams
= 100 - 65
= 35
Cost of each ice-cream
= 140 ÷ 35
= $4
Total amount collected from the sale of all the ice-creams
= 270 x 4
= $1080
Answer(s): (a) 25.9%; (b) $1080
